骨硬化蛋白及其与健康社区老年人和青少年骨代谢标志物及性激素的关联。

Sclerostin and Its Associations With Bone Metabolism Markers and Sex Hormones in Healthy Community-Dwelling Elderly Individuals and Adolescents.

Abstract

Sclerostin is an important regulator of bone mass involving Wnt/β-catenin signaling pathway. We aimed to obtain the profile of serum sclerostin level and explore its associations with bone metabolism markers and sex hormones in healthy community-dwelling Chinese elderly individuals and adolescents. A cross-sectional study was performed in three communities in Shanghai. In all, 861 participants, including 574 healthy elderly individuals, and 287 healthy adolescents, were recruited. The levels of serum sclerostin, procollagen type 1 N-terminal propeptide (P1NP), β-CrossLaps of type I collagen containing cross-linked C-telopeptide (β-CTX), parathyroid hormone (PTH), 25-hydroxyvitamin D [25(OH)D], estradiol (E), testosterone (T), and sex hormone-binding globulin (SHBG) were measured in blood samples from all participants. Median sclerostin level was higher in males than in females and in elderly individuals than in adolescents (elderly males: 54.89 pmol/L, elderly females: 39.95 pmol/L, adolescent males: 36.58 pmol/L, adolescent females: 27.06 pmol/L; both < 0.05). In elderly individuals, serum sclerostin was positively correlated with age (β = 0.176, < 0.001) and T (β = 0.248, = 0.001), but negatively associated to P1NP (β = -0.140, = 0.001). In adolescents, circulating sclerostin was significantly and positively associated with P1NP (β = 0.192, = 0.003). The directions of the association between sclerostin and P1NP were opposite in Chinese elderly individuals and adolescents, which may reflect that sclerostin plays distinct roles in different functional states of the skeleton. Our findings revealed the rough profile of circulating sclerostin level in general healthy Chinese population and its associations with bone metabolism markers and sex hormones, which may provide a clue to further elucidate the cross action of sclerostin in bone metabolism and sexual development.

摘要

硬化素是涉及Wnt/β-连环蛋白信号通路的骨量重要调节因子。我们旨在获取健康社区居住的中国老年人和青少年血清硬化素水平概况,并探讨其与骨代谢标志物及性激素的关联。在上海的三个社区开展了一项横断面研究。共招募了861名参与者,包括574名健康老年人和287名健康青少年。检测了所有参与者血样中血清硬化素、1型前胶原N端前肽(P1NP)、含交联C末端肽的I型胶原β-交联C末端肽(β-CTX)、甲状旁腺激素(PTH)、25-羟基维生素D [25(OH)D]、雌二醇(E)、睾酮(T)和性激素结合球蛋白(SHBG)的水平。男性的血清硬化素水平中位数高于女性,老年人高于青少年(老年男性:54.89 pmol/L,老年女性:39.95 pmol/L,青少年男性:36.58 pmol/L,青少年女性:27.06 pmol/L;均P<0.05)。在老年人中,血清硬化素与年龄呈正相关(β = 0.176,P<0.001)及T呈正相关(β = 0.248,P = 0.001),但与P1NP呈负相关(β = -0.140,P = 0.001)。在青少年中,循环硬化素与P1NP显著正相关(β = 0.192,P = 0.003)。硬化素与P1NP之间的关联方向在中国老年人和青少年中相反,这可能反映出硬化素在骨骼不同功能状态中发挥着不同作用。我们的研究结果揭示了一般健康中国人群循环硬化素水平概况及其与骨代谢标志物和性激素的关联,这可能为进一步阐明硬化素在骨代谢和性发育中的交叉作用提供线索。
